
Blues Recall Polak
Published on March 11, 2008 under American Hockey League (AHL)
Peoria Rivermen News Release
The St. Louis Blues announced today that they have recalled defenseman Roman Polak on emergency conditions from the Peoria Rivermen.
Polak, 21, has appeared in 28 games with Peoria this season, posting six assists and 15 penalty minutes. The Ostrava, Czech Republic native split time between St. Louis and Peoria in his rookie season last year, playing 53 games with Peoria (4-8-12, 66 PIMs) and 19 in St. Louis (0-0-0, 6 PIMs). Polak was recalled earlier this season to the Blues but did not dress.
He will be available for St. Louis' game tonight against the Oilers in Edmonton at 8 pm CST.
